Oil-Based Polyurethane Choices
Oil-based polyurethane choices are preferred choices for refinishing wood floorings due to their resilience and rich finish. These finishes supply a robust protective layer that boosts the wood's natural beauty while standing up to scratches and use. Offered in different luster degrees, including matte, satin, and shiny, oil-based polyurethanes enable house owners to choose an appearance that matches their interior style. The application procedure commonly includes sanding the flooring to ensure correct bond, complied with by numerous layers of polyurethane. Oil-based finishes take longer to completely dry and release stronger smells throughout application, their longevity makes them a popular choice. In addition, they are understood for their capability to grow the shade of the timber gradually, developing a warm, welcoming look.
Water-Based Finishing Choices
Water-based surfaces offer an excellent option for refinishing hardwood floors, providing a quick-drying alternative that lessens smell during application. These surfaces usually have fewer unpredictable natural substances (VOCs), making them a much more environmentally pleasant choice. Offered in different lusters, consisting of matte, satin, and gloss, water-based finishes enable for adaptability in achieving the preferred aesthetic. They penetrate the timber surface successfully, improving the all-natural grain without altering its shade considerably. In addition, water-based finishes have a tendency to be extra resistant to yellowing over time compared to oil-based options. They may need more frequent reapplication due to their reduced resilience under heavy foot web traffic. Generally, water-based coatings are perfect for house owners seeking a quickly, low-odor refinishing solution.
Examining the Problem of Your Floorings
Just how can homeowners establish if their timber floorings need redecorating? The analysis begins with an aesthetic assessment. Homeowners need to look for indications of wear, such as scrapes, dents, and discoloration. A flooring that shows up boring or lacks radiance might additionally indicate that refinishing is necessary. Additionally, home owners can do the water test: a couple of decreases of water should grain externally; if it soaks in, the coating may be compromised.Sound can also be a sign; squeaking or standing out noises when strolling on the floor might recommend deeper issues. Homeowners ought to consider the age of the coating; typically, wood floors need redecorating every 7 to 10 years, depending on website traffic and upkeep. Generally, a complete examination will help figure out when it's time to engage a refinishing solution to restore the appeal of the wood floorings.

Sanding and Ending Up Techniques
Sanding is a vital step in the timber flooring redecorating procedure that restores the surface area to its original gloss. This strategy eliminates old coatings, scratches, and flaws, producing a smooth base for new coatings. Generally, a drum sander is used for huge areas, while side sanders deal with corners and elaborate areas. Multiple grits of sandpaper are used, beginning with crude grit and proceeding to finer selections, ensuring a polished finish.After sanding, the floor is extensively vacuumed and cleaned up to get rid of dust. The finishing procedure complies with, which involves applying sealants or discolorations to improve shade and safeguard the wood. Numerous ending up alternatives, such as water-based or oil-based surfaces, supply various appearances and toughness, accommodating diverse preferences and requirements.
Approximated Costs and Budgeting for Refinishing
While planning a wood flooring redecorating job, home owners often discover themselves contemplating the approximated costs involved. The overall expense for refinishing hardwood floors generally 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ending upon different aspects such as the size of the area, the kind of timber, and the selected surface. For an average space of 300 square feet, this could imply a budget of approximately $900 to $2,400. Homeowners should likewise think about extra expenses, consisting of furnishings removal, repair services to the timber, and prospective assessments with professionals. If opting for do it yourself methods, expenses for fining sand tools and ending up items must be factored in too. To stay clear of shocks, it is recommended to obtain numerous quotes from regional specialists and create a detailed spending plan that includes all prospective expenditures. This positive technique assurances monetary preparedness and establishes reasonable expectations for the redecorating project.
Tips for Maintaining Your Newly Refinished Floors
Normal maintenance is vital for protecting the elegance and long life of newly redecorated timber floorings. House owners ought to establish a cleaning regimen that consists of sweeping or vacuuming to get rid of dirt and debris, which can scrape the surface. Using a damp wipe with a pH-balanced cleaner especially designed for timber floors is advised, preventing too much wetness that can harm the finish.To stop wear, placing felt pads under furniture legs is essential. When relocating products, this lowers the danger of scratches. Additionally, location carpets can be purposefully placed in high-traffic zones to supply added protection.Humidity degrees should be kept an eye on, as timber expands and agreements with adjustments in wetness. Preserving a secure indoor environment can help prevent warping. Staying clear of shoes with difficult soles and immediately cleaning up spills will even more guard the flooring's stability, ensuring it remains a magnificent attribute of the home for years to come.
